How Often Should You Get Breast Fat Transfer in Cork?

Breast fat transfer, also known as fat grafting or lipofilling, is a cosmetic procedure that involves transferring fat from one part of the body to the breasts to enhance their size and shape. This method offers a natural alternative to breast implants and is becoming increasingly popular among women seeking subtle enhancements. If you are considering a breast fat transfer in Cork, understanding the frequency of such procedures is crucial for maintaining optimal results and ensuring your safety.

How often should you get Breast Fat Transfer in Cork

1. Initial Procedure and Recovery

The first breast fat transfer procedure typically involves harvesting fat from areas like the abdomen, thighs, or hips using liposuction. This fat is then purified and injected into the breasts to achieve the desired volume and contour. The recovery period generally lasts about one to two weeks, during which you should avoid strenuous activities and follow your surgeon's post-operative instructions carefully.

2. Factors Affecting Longevity of Results

The longevity of the results from a breast fat transfer can vary based on several factors. These include the quality of the harvested fat, the technique used for injection, and individual metabolic rates. Typically, about 60-70% of the transferred fat survives and integrates into the breast tissue, providing a natural and long-lasting enhancement. However, some of the fat may be reabsorbed by the body over time, which can necessitate additional procedures.

3. Follow-Up Procedures

While the initial breast fat transfer can provide significant and lasting results, some patients may choose to undergo follow-up procedures to maintain or enhance their outcomes. These follow-up sessions are typically spaced several years apart, depending on the individual's rate of fat reabsorption and their aesthetic goals. It is essential to consult with your surgeon to determine the appropriate timing for any subsequent procedures.

4. Considerations for Future Pregnancies

Pregnancy can significantly impact the results of a breast fat transfer. Hormonal changes and weight fluctuations associated with pregnancy can alter the shape and volume of the breasts. Therefore, it is often recommended that women consider undergoing a breast fat transfer after they have completed their family planning. If future pregnancies are planned, discussing this with your surgeon can help in managing expectations and planning for potential touch-up procedures post-pregnancy.

5. Maintenance and Lifestyle Factors

Maintaining a stable weight through a healthy lifestyle can help preserve the results of a breast fat transfer. Significant weight fluctuations can affect the volume and shape of the breasts. Additionally, avoiding smoking and excessive alcohol consumption can promote better healing and longer-lasting results. Regular follow-ups with your surgeon are also recommended to monitor the outcomes and address any concerns promptly.

FAQ

Q: How long do the results of a breast fat transfer last?

A: The results can last several years, but individual factors like metabolic rate and lifestyle can influence the longevity. Typically, follow-up procedures are considered after several years to maintain the desired outcome.

Q: Can I undergo a breast fat transfer if I plan to have children in the future?

A: While it is possible, it is often recommended to consider the procedure after completing family planning due to potential changes during pregnancy. Discussing future pregnancies with your surgeon is crucial.

Q: How many follow-up procedures are typically needed?

A: The number of follow-up procedures can vary based on individual factors and aesthetic goals. Some patients may require one or two additional sessions, while others may not need any.

Q: Are there any risks associated with breast fat transfer?

A: Like any surgical procedure, breast fat transfer carries risks such as infection, asymmetry, and unevenness. However, these risks are generally low when performed by a qualified and experienced surgeon.
